The Secret Spell To Spelling

The Secret Spell To Spelling PDF Author: Alexander Mole
Publisher: Rethink Press
ISBN: 9781781332429
Category : Juvenile Nonfiction
Languages : en
Pages : 56

Book Description
The Secret Spell To Spelling teaches a visual spelling strategy called "the split method" that enables you to spell any word of your choice. Imagine being able to take photos of all the correctly spelled words into a test with you. You could just copy the words and get the answers right. This method allows you to do just that. Alex says: "This book tells you about the split method. I call it the split method because you split the word into two, three or four parts depending on how long the word is. My mum is an NLP trainer and she taught me this when I was seven. She learned this method from Dr Richard Bandler. This method is perfect for your children or yourself "

Sue's Strategies Best Spelling Choices

Sue's Strategies Best Spelling Choices PDF Author: Susan B Kahn Med
Publisher:
ISBN: 9781701543140
Category :
Languages : en
Pages : 49

Book Description
Uncover some secrets for better spelling!Sue's Strategies(R) explains numerous spelling secrets about letters and suffixes. For example, what letters are used to make the K sound: C, K, CK, CH? How do you choose the right spelling? Also, why does the AGE in the word, stage, make an A sound when AGE in luggage sounds entirely different? This text clarifies many concepts by explaining various spelling strategies and their importance. Solve spelling mysteries with Sue's Strategies Best Spelling Choices.
